Although the AD-3W had some ability to spot submarines, there was thought given to development of a specialized "hunter-killer" Skyraider team for the antisubmarine warfare (ASW) role. To this end, two AD-3W AEW machines were modified to a "hunter" configuration designated the "AD-3E", and two AD-3N night attack machines were modified to a "killer" configuration designated the "AD-3S". Sources are very unclear as to the specific modifications. In any case, the scheme didn't go into operation; the Navy had moved on to the notion of using a single aircraft to perform both the "hunter" and the "killer" missions. Interest remained in developing a Skyraider variant that could perform the dual mission.
